The Video Intelligence Streaming API supports live label detection with
streaming input of multimedia data, and streaming output of analysis results in
real-time.
The following
JSON configuration object
shows how to use
AIStreamer
live label detection to annotate a streaming video.
{
"video_config" : {
"feature" : "STREAMING_LABEL_DETECTION" ,
"label_detection_config" : {
"stationary_camera" : "False"
}
}
}
The AIStreamer returns a response similar to the following example.
Reading response.
0.0s: mustang horse (0.9374721646308899)
0.0s: herd (0.9230296611785889)
0.0s: horse (0.9789802432060242)
